The short answer

For most visitors, a community homestay in the valley villages is the standout choice: it puts you in the heart of farming life with home-cooked meals and easy access to the cheese farm, temples and salt trail. If the lake is your priority, look at simple options around Markhu and Kulekhani.

By area

Valley community homestays

The valley's community homestays are the signature way to stay, hosted by Newari farming families in traditional slate-roofed homes. Best for travellers who want authentic rural hospitality and a central base for the goat-cheese farm, Newari temples and the salt-trade trail.

Simple lodges and resorts

A handful of small lodges and modest resorts dot the valley for those who prefer a private room with a few more facilities. Standards are simple — this is countryside, not a resort town.

Near Kulekhani and Markhu

For a lake-focused trip, basic lakeside options around Markhu and Kulekhani reservoir put you steps from the boats, though the valley itself remains the more rounded base.

What to expect from a homestay

Because homestays are the backbone of staying in Chitlang, it helps to know what they involve. Rooms are simple and clean, usually in a family farmhouse, with shared or basic bathrooms and meals eaten with your hosts. The trade-off for fewer facilities is genuine hospitality, home-cooked food and a window into rural Newari life that no hotel can match. If you need more privacy or comfort, a small lodge is the better fit, but you will lose some of that personal connection.

How to choose

Match your base to your main goal. Coming for culture and slow travel? Choose a valley homestay near the temples and cheese farm. Coming mainly for the lake? A lakeside option near Markhu saves driving. Travelling with less mobility or young children? A simple lodge with private rooms may suit better than a multi-storey farmhouse. Whatever you pick, arrange it in advance through the community homestay network or a trusted local operator rather than turning up and hoping.

Good to know

  • Book ahead for weekends and festivals, when the valley fills with domestic visitors.
  • Bring cash — there are no ATMs in the valley.
  • Nights are cool year-round at this elevation; pack a warm layer.
  • Flag any dietary needs when booking, since meals are home-cooked and simple.

Frequently asked questions

Where is the best place to stay in Chitlang?+

For most visitors, a community homestay in the valley villages is the best base — it puts you in the heart of rural life with home-cooked meals and easy access to the cheese farm, temples and salt trail. Lakeside options near Markhu suit lake-focused trips.

Does Chitlang have hotels or resorts?+

Chitlang is primarily a homestay and small-lodge destination rather than a hotel town, which is part of its appeal. You'll find family homestays and a few simple lodges and resorts, with more basic lakeside options around Markhu and Kulekhani.

Do you need to book accommodation in advance?+

Yes, especially at weekends and during festivals, when the valley is busiest with domestic visitors. Booking ahead through the community homestay network also helps spread guests fairly between households.

Can you stay near Kulekhani lake?+

Yes — there are simple lakeside options around Markhu and the reservoir for travellers who want to focus on boating, though most people base in the Chitlang valley itself and visit the lake on a day outing.
